Symbolic AI Examples: An In-Depth Exploration
Imagine a computer system that thinks and reasons like a human expert—making diagnoses like a doctor, analyzing financial data like a seasoned trader, or solving complex mathematical proofs like a mathematician. Welcome to the world of Symbolic Artificial Intelligence (AI), where machines manipulate symbols and concepts using logical rules to solve complex problems.
Unlike the data-hungry machine learning systems dominating today’s AI headlines, Symbolic AI takes a different approach. Instead of learning patterns from massive datasets, it relies on explicitly encoded human knowledge and logical reasoning—much like learning mathematics through rules and formulas rather than analyzing millions of solved problems.
A classic example is medical diagnostic systems that use if-then rules to reach conclusions. When a patient reports symptoms, the system applies logical rules like: “IF patient has fever AND cough AND difficulty breathing THEN investigate possible pneumonia.” This mirrors how human doctors think through diagnoses using their medical knowledge and reasoning.
Symbolic AI is particularly valuable for its ability to explain its decision-making process. Unlike the “black box” nature of neural networks, Symbolic AI systems can show exactly which rules and logical steps led to their conclusions. This transparency is crucial in fields like healthcare and finance where understanding the “why” behind decisions is as important as the decisions themselves.
However, Symbolic AI has limitations. While it excels at well-defined problems with clear rules, it can struggle with the fuzzy, uncertain nature of the real world where rules aren’t always black and white. Modern hybrid approaches are beginning to bridge this gap, combining the logical reasoning of Symbolic AI with the pattern recognition capabilities of machine learning.
Real-World Applications of Symbolic AI
Symbolic AI is transforming critical domains like healthcare, robotics, and natural language understanding. These applications demonstrate how rule-based artificial intelligence can tackle complex real-world challenges with precision and interpretability.
In medical diagnosis, Symbolic AI systems use predefined diagnostic rules to analyze patient symptoms and suggest potential conditions. For example, recent research in medical AI shows how combining symbolic reasoning with physician judgment improves diagnostic accuracy while maintaining explainability, crucial in healthcare where understanding the reasoning process is essential.
The robotics industry uses Symbolic AI for navigation and movement control. Instead of relying solely on neural networks, robots use explicit rule sets for path planning and obstacle avoidance. This hybrid approach allows robots to follow clear, verifiable guidelines while adapting to their environment, essential in manufacturing, warehouse automation, and space exploration.
Expert systems are another significant application area where Symbolic AI encodes human expertise into actionable knowledge bases. These systems help professionals make complex decisions by applying logical rules derived from years of domain experience. From financial trading to industrial troubleshooting, expert systems continue to demonstrate the practical value of symbolic reasoning.
Natural language processing (NLP) applications benefit from Symbolic AI’s structured approach. By incorporating grammatical rules and semantic frameworks, NLP systems better understand context and meaning in human communication. This has led to more reliable language translation tools, chatbots, and document analysis systems that can explain their reasoning process step by step.
A promising development is the integration of Symbolic AI with modern machine learning approaches. This combination enables systems to leverage both the precision of rule-based reasoning and the pattern recognition capabilities of neural networks. Such hybrid solutions are increasingly deployed in autonomous vehicles, smart manufacturing, and intelligent decision support systems.
Application | Symbolic AI Approach | Neural Network Approach | Hybrid Approach |
---|---|---|---|
Medical Diagnosis | Uses predefined diagnostic rules to analyze symptoms | Analyzes medical imaging data to recognize patterns | Combines imaging analysis with medical knowledge and protocols |
Robotics | Uses explicit rule sets for navigation and obstacle avoidance | Processes raw sensor data to identify objects and assess conditions | Combines sensor data processing with logical decision-making |
Natural Language Processing | Incorporates grammatical rules and semantic frameworks | Uses deep learning to understand and generate language | Combines language models with logical reasoning for context understanding |
Financial Analysis | Applies logical rules derived from domain expertise | Analyzes large datasets to identify patterns and trends | Combines data analysis with expert knowledge for decision support |
Autonomous Vehicles | Follows explicit navigation rules and safety protocols | Processes raw sensor data to identify objects and conditions | Combines perception with logical decision-making for navigation |
Advantages and Disadvantages of Symbolic AI
At its core, Symbolic AI excels in providing transparent, rule-based reasoning that closely mirrors human logical thinking processes. Unlike black-box machine learning models, symbolic systems offer clear visibility into their decision-making pathways, making them particularly valuable for applications where interpretability is crucial.
The explicit knowledge representation in Symbolic AI delivers several compelling advantages. By using formal logic and structured rules, these systems can effectively encode complex domain knowledge in a human-readable format. This transparency enables developers to easily validate the reasoning process and trace how conclusions are reached—a critical requirement in fields like healthcare, finance, and legal technology where decisions must be explainable.
Another significant strength lies in Symbolic AI’s ability to operate effectively with limited data. Unlike modern machine learning approaches that require massive datasets for training, symbolic systems can function with a well-defined set of rules and knowledge bases. This makes them particularly suitable for domains where data is scarce but expert knowledge is abundant.
Since symbolic AI is based on explicitly defined rules and symbols, it is easy to understand how a decision was made. This transparency makes debugging and improving the system more straightforward.
However, Symbolic AI faces notable challenges that limit its applicability in certain scenarios. One of its primary weaknesses is the difficulty in handling unstructured data and ambiguous information. The rigid rule-based nature of symbolic systems makes them less effective at processing natural language, images, or other forms of data that don’t fit neatly into predefined categories.
Scalability presents another significant hurdle. As research has shown, when the domain of knowledge expands, the number of symbols and rules needed to represent it increases exponentially. This can make managing large-scale symbolic systems unwieldy and computationally intensive.
The system’s adaptability is also limited compared to modern machine learning approaches. Symbolic AI typically requires manual programming and struggles to learn from new experiences or adapt to changing environments without human intervention. This inflexibility can be particularly problematic in dynamic domains where conditions frequently change.
Perhaps most challenging is Symbolic AI’s struggle with real-world ambiguity. While humans can easily navigate uncertain or incomplete information, symbolic systems require precise input and well-defined rules to function effectively. This limitation can make it difficult to apply symbolic approaches to complex real-world scenarios where information is often imperfect or ambiguous.
Understanding these strengths and limitations is crucial for developers and organizations considering Symbolic AI for their projects. While it excels in domains requiring logical reasoning and transparency, alternative approaches or hybrid solutions might be more appropriate for applications involving unstructured data or requiring adaptive learning capabilities.
Hybrid Approaches: Combining Symbolic AI with Neural Networks
Neuro-symbolic AI represents a significant advancement in artificial intelligence, merging the pattern-recognition capabilities of neural networks with the explicit logic and reasoning of symbolic systems. This hybrid approach aims to create more robust and interpretable AI solutions that can both learn from data and apply logical rules.
At its core, neuro-symbolic systems leverage neural networks to handle complex, unstructured data like images, text, and sensor readings, while symbolic components provide reasoning frameworks that can apply rules and make logical deductions. Recent research has shown that these hybrid systems demonstrate superior performance in tasks requiring both pattern recognition and logical reasoning.
A compelling example of this hybrid approach is the Neuro-Symbolic Concept Learner (NSCL), developed by researchers at MIT and IBM. This system combines neural networks for visual processing with symbolic reasoning for answering questions about images. NSCL can learn from significantly less training data while producing more explainable results than pure neural network approaches.
In autonomous driving applications, hybrid systems demonstrate remarkable versatility. Neural networks process raw sensor data to identify objects and assess road conditions, while symbolic reasoning layers help make logical decisions about navigation rules and safety protocols. This combination enables safer and more reliable autonomous vehicles that can both perceive their environment and follow traffic regulations.
The healthcare sector has also embraced hybrid approaches, where neural networks analyze medical imaging data while symbolic systems apply medical knowledge and protocols. This integration helps doctors make more informed diagnoses while maintaining transparency in the decision-making process – a crucial factor in medical applications.
Neuro-symbolic AI represents the best of both worlds – the adaptability of neural networks combined with the reliability of symbolic reasoning. These systems are not just more capable; they’re also more trustworthy.
Artur Garcez, AI Researcher
Looking ahead, researchers are developing increasingly sophisticated hybrid architectures that can handle more complex reasoning tasks while maintaining the learning capabilities that make neural networks so powerful. These advancements suggest a future where AI systems can better emulate human-like reasoning while remaining transparent and trustworthy.
Future Directions in Symbolic AI
The landscape of Symbolic AI stands at a fascinating crossroads, where traditional rule-based systems merge with cutting-edge neural networks to create more powerful hybrid solutions. Researchers are actively exploring neural-symbolic systems that leverage the logical rigor of symbolic AI while harnessing the adaptive learning capabilities of neural networks, as demonstrated in pioneering work by foundational theorists and contemporary innovators.
These emerging hybrid approaches show particular promise in addressing complex real-world challenges that have historically proven difficult for pure symbolic systems. For instance, in medical diagnostics, neural-symbolic AI systems can combine explicit medical knowledge with pattern recognition to provide more accurate and interpretable diagnoses. The integration helps overcome traditional limitations while maintaining the transparency that makes symbolic AI so valuable in critical applications.
Looking ahead, the field is moving toward more sophisticated applications that can handle uncertainty and ambiguity—longtime challenges for classical symbolic systems. Future developments will likely see enhanced capabilities in areas like automated reasoning, knowledge representation, and dynamic problem-solving, making these systems more adaptable to real-world complexity.
A particularly exciting frontier lies in the development of explainable AI systems that combine symbolic reasoning with modern machine learning techniques. This convergence promises to deliver AI solutions that are not only powerful but also transparent and trustworthy—a crucial consideration as AI systems become more deeply integrated into critical decision-making processes.
As research continues to advance, we can expect to see symbolic AI evolve into an even more vital component of the artificial intelligence landscape, working in concert with other methodologies to create more capable, efficient, and reliable systems that can tackle increasingly complex challenges across various domains.
Last updated:
Disclaimer: The information presented in this article is for general informational purposes only and is provided as is. While we strive to keep the content up-to-date and accurate, we make no representations or warranties of any kind, express or implied, about the completeness, accuracy, reliability, suitability, or availability of the information contained in this article.
Any reliance you place on such information is strictly at your own risk. We reserve the right to make additions, deletions, or modifications to the contents of this article at any time without prior notice.
In no event will we be liable for any loss or damage including without limitation, indirect or consequential loss or damage, or any loss or damage whatsoever arising from loss of data, profits, or any other loss not specified herein arising out of, or in connection with, the use of this article.
Despite our best efforts, this article may contain oversights, errors, or omissions. If you notice any inaccuracies or have concerns about the content, please report them through our content feedback form. Your input helps us maintain the quality and reliability of our information.